The Power of Natural Textures in Visual Design
Modern aesthetics have shifted towards authenticity and warmth. While clean white backgrounds remain popular for e-commerce, they can sometimes feel sterile or overly clinical. Introducing organic elements like wood grain adds depth, character, and a sense of craftsmanship to your visual assets. This approach aligns perfectly with current design trends that prioritize human connection and tactile experiences in digital spaces.
When you utilize a minimalistic mockup featuring a wooden board, you create a neutral yet sophisticated stage for your content. Whether you are showcasing a bold logo, a delicate typography set, or a vibrant color palette, the natural tones of the wood provide a perfect contrast that allows your creative elements to pop without competing for attention. This balance is crucial for maintaining a strong visual hierarchy and ensuring that your message remains clear and impactful.

Selecting the Right Assets for Your Workflow
When evaluating design resources, consider how well the mockup integrates with your existing brand system. Does the wood tone complement your chosen color palette? Is the texture too busy, or does it provide the subtle background noise needed to ground your design? A good mockup should enhance readability and scalability, ensuring that your text and graphics remain legible at any size.
To get the most out of your creative projects, pay attention to the lighting and perspective within the mockup file. A well-lit scene will make your colors appear more accurate and your typography sharper. By choosing a clean, minimalistic option, you give yourself the freedom to add custom lighting or props later if needed, giving you full control over the final aesthetic.
